Cardiopulmonary Services

Our team of qualified respiratory therapists offers a range of services for both our inpatient and outpatient community needs. We specialize in the evaluation and treatment of pulmonary diseases that include, but are not limited to, asthma, COPD (chronic obstructive pulmonary disease), emphysema and chronic bronchitis.

SVH Respiratory works with your primary care provider in all aspects of airway management, including non-invasive and mechanical ventilation, nebulizers, oxygen delivery, and all modes of airway hygiene for your inpatient stay.

Our outpatient services include:

  • 24 and 48 hour Holter Monitors and Scanning - test to diagnose cardiac arrhythmias
  • Event Monitoring
  • Pulmonary Function Studies - test to diagnose lung function
  • Stress Tests - cardiac tests to diagnose abnormalities
    • Exercise Stress Test - use of treadmill for testing (medication available for patients who are unable to walk for any length of time)
    • Nuclear Stress Test - treadmill used in conjunction with nuclear scanning
    • Echocardiogram Stress Test - treadmill used in conjunction with ultrasound
  • Ankle-Brachial Index (ABI) test - a painless exam used to diagnose peripheral arterial disease that can lead to heart attack and stroke.
  • Pulmonary Rehabilitation - an education program emphasizing breathing retraining with physical reconditioning, pacing, and how to manage your daily activities without becoming exhausted. Ask your primary care provider for a referral and we will do the rest.
  • Smoking Cessation Counseling - offered to both our inpatients and outpatients
